Abstract

Devices and methods are disclosed for establishing interaction among electronic devices of an environment. The device has a transmitter, receiver, memory for storing interaction rules, and a processor for learning the interaction rules in association with the transmitter, receiver, and other devices of the environment. The device also includes components for performing the device specific functions and a state sensor for determining the logical or physical state of the device. Methods involve observing at one or more devices change of state activity among the plurality of devices through receiving a change of state message that is transmitted to the one or more devices. A set of rules are learned at the one or more devices based upon observing the change of state activity. The learned set of rules are then applied at the one or more devices to automatically control changes of state of devices within the plurality of devices.

Claims (37)

1. A method, comprising:

receiving, by a device, an electronic message sent from a different device in a plurality of networked devices, the electronic message identifying a change of state implemented by the different device when playing media content;

querying, by the device, an electronic database for the change of state, the electronic database having electronic associations between rules and possible changes of state to identify and retrieve a rule of the rules that is electronically associated with the change of state identified in the electronic message;

determining, by the device, a learning mode of operation associated with the plurality of networked devices;

determining, by the device based on the rule, a broadcast requirement during the learning mode of operation; and

broadcasting, by the device, the change of state to network addresses associated with the plurality of networked devices, the change of state identifying the different device implementing the change of state to play the media content.
